Transaction 3889e6c04792276a1648b983974fd4da194600c86c22825b2b831bb1d576ed55
1 Input
1 Output
-
3889e6c04792276a1648b983974fd4da194600c86c22825b2b831bb1d576ed55:0
- value
- 14689761
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5e37df842642e589ce035e1644a4fa0c5311529
- address
- bc1quh3hm7zzvsh9388qxhskgjj05rznz9ffd72dda